Abstract
In recent years, evaluating the region manufacturing innovation Ability has gained a renewed interest in both growth economists and trade economists. In this work, a two-stage architecture constructed by combining independent component analysis (ICA) and the data envelopment analysis (DEA) is proposed for evolution region manufacturing innovation. In the first stage, ICA is used as feature extraction. In the second stage, DEA is used to evolution region manufacturing innovation efficiency. By examining the region manufacturing innovation data, it is shown that the proposed method achieves is effective and feasible. And it provides a better estimate tool for the region manufacturing innovation activity. It also provides a novel way for the evolution design of the other engineering.
